文章主题:人工智能技术, 知识问答AI助手, ChatGPT, 优势
随着人工智能技术的发展,知识问答AI助手正在为用户提供更加智能的问答服务与体验。
大家在学生时期,会经历很多各种考试,那遇到不会的试题时,能不能交给AI助手帮我们去解决呢?它们能给出正确的答案吗?估计很多小伙伴和我有同样的想法。
笔者虽然早已经不是学生,但因为工作的需要,最近的这段时间在备战软考,期间做了很多的综合练习题(选择题),那么,今天我就选取了两道软考的选择题做作为测试样例,对目前支持中文问答的几个AI助手做测试, 话不多说,开干。ChatGPT vs Claude vs 通义千问 vs 文心一言
试题一:
在实时操作系统中,两个任务并发执行,一个任务要等待另一个任务发来消息,或建立某个条件后再向前执行,这种制约性合作关系被称为任务的( ),从以下选项中选出一项。A.同步B.互斥C.调度D.执行1、ChatGPT的回答:
在实时操作系统中,两个任务并发执行,一个任务要等待另一个任务发来消息或满足某个条件后再向前执行的制约性合作关系被称为任务的同步。因此,正确答案是:同步。2、Claude 的回答:
在实时操作系统中,两个任务之间通过消息通信或条件变量在逻辑上实现同步,这种关系被称为任务的同步(Synchronization)。所以正确选项为:A. 同步选项分析:A. 同步:两个任务通过合作机制实现同步执行,正确选项。B. 互斥:两个任务在同一时间最多只有一个任务可以访问共享资源,以避免冲突,错误选项。 C. 调度:操作系统根据任务的优先级与状态安排其获取系统资源的顺序,错误选项。D. 执行:操作系统安排任务在处理器上运行并执行,错误选项。在本例中,两个任务之间基于消息或条件变量实现逻辑上的同步与合作,实现一个任务等待另一个任务的操作后再继续执行的关系。这种制约性合作关系属于同步,故选项A同步为正确选项。其他选项描述的都是与任务执行或共享资源相关的概念,但不是两个任务之间合作同步的关系,属于错误选项。所以本例中,选项A同步正确地描述了两个任务之间的同步关系,是正确选项。其他选项属于错误选项,不正确地描述了该关系。这一判断分析是准确的。希望这个例子可以帮助您理解任务同步与相关概念。如果您对实时操作系统的任务管理及调度还有任何问题,请提出,我将提供详细的解答与指导。3、通义千问的回答:
D.执行。任务的执行是指一个或多个处理器或计算机程序,在给定的时间内完成其功能或规定的操作。在实时操作系统中,两个任务并发执行,当一个任务等待另一个任务发来消息时,这两个任务称为同步任务,它们必须在给定的时间内完成它们的操作。例如,在I/O操作系统中,完成读取或写入操作需要同时访问多个设备,必须使用同步机制来确保两个操作的交替进行。而一些计算密集型的操作任务则可以是非同步的,这些任务可以在相互独立的情况下执行,不需要保持同步。因此,任务的执行是被选中的选项。4、文心一言的回答:
在实时操作系统中,两个任务并发执行,一个任务要等待另一个任务发来消息,或建立某种条件后再向前执行,这种制约性合作关系被称为任务的互斥。试题一结果:正确答案为 A. 同步
从试题一可以看出,ChatGPT和claude回答正确,最优秀的是claude,不但给出了答案,还给出了过程分析。
而,通义千问和文心一言回答错误。
试题二:
数据库的视图与基本表之间通过建立( )之间的映像,保证数据的逻辑独立性;基本表与存储文件之间通过建立( )之间的映像,保证数据的物理 独立性。请在以下选项中补充括号内的内容。问题1选项A.模式到内模式B.外模式到内模式C.外模式到模式D.外模式到外模式问题2选项A.模式到内模式B.外模式到内模式C.外模式到模式D.外模式到外模式1、ChatGPT的回答:
问题1选项中,正确答案是:C.外模式到模式。问题2选项中,正确答案是:A.模式到内模式。解释如下:数据库的视图与基本表之间通过建立外模式到模式之间的映像,保证数据的逻辑独立性。视图是从一个或多个基本表中派生出来的虚拟表,它可以根据用户需求进行定义和筛选,提供了一种不同于基本表的数据展示方式。通过外模式(也称为用户模式)到模式(也称为概念模式)之间的映像,可以将用户对视图的操作与底层基本表的物理实现相分离,从而保证了数据的逻辑独立性。基本表与存储文件之间通过建立模式到内模式之间的映像,保证数据的物理独立性。模式是数据库的逻辑结构和组织方式,描述了数据库中各个表、字段以及它们之间的关系。内模式(也称为物理模式)则描述了数据在存储介质上的实际存储方式和物理结构。通过模式到内模式之间的映像,可以将基本表的逻辑表示与底层存储文件的物理布局相分离,使得数据库的物理实现可以独立于数据的逻辑表示,从而保证了数据的物理独立性。因此,正确的选项是:问题1:C.外模式到模式问题2:A.模式到内模式2、Claude 的回答:
数据库的视图与基本表之间通过建立模式到外模式之间的映射,保证数据的逻辑独立性。基本表与存储文件之间通过建立内模式到外模式之间的映射,保证数据的物理独立性。所以正确选项为:问题1选项:C.外模式到模式问题2选项:D.内模式到外模式选项分析:问题1:A. 模式到内模式:错误选项,不正确描述视图与表的映射关系。B. 外模式到内模式:错误选项,不正确描述视图与表的映射关系。C. 外模式到模式:正确选项,描述视图(外模式)到表(模式)的映射关系。D. 外模式到外模式:错误选项,不正确描述视图与表的映射关系。问题2:A. 模式到内模式:错误选项,不正确描述表与文件之间的映射关系。B. 外模式到内模式:错误选项,不正确描述表与文件之间的映射关系。C. 外模式到模式:错误选项,不正确描述表与文件之间的映射关系。D. 内模式到外模式:正确选项,描述表(内模式)到文件(外模式)的映射关系。所以问题1 的正确选项是C. 外模式到模式,描述视图与表之间的映射。问题2 的正确选项是D. 内模式到外模式,描述表与文件之间的映射。这两个选择都正确地描述了数据库的两级映像以实现数据的逻辑独立性与物理独立性。其他选项都不正确地描述了相关的映射关系,属于错误选项。希望这个例子可以帮助您理解数据库的两级映像及其实现的数据独立性。如果您对数据库的架构与原理还有任何问题,请提出,我将提供详细的解答与指导。3、通义千问的回答:
问题1选项:A.模式到内模式:模式(表名)存储在内存中,内模式是对应表中存储数据的部分,通过建立映像,实现了数据的逻辑独立性。B.外模式到内模式:外模式(视图名)存储在内存中,内模式是对应表中存储数据的部分,通过建立映像,实现了数据的物理独立性。C.外模式到模式:模式(表名)存储在磁盘中,模式是对应表中存储数据的部分,通过建立映像,实现了数据的逻辑独立性。D.外模式到外模式:外模式(视图名)存储在磁盘中,视图是对应表中存储数据的部分,通过建立映像,实现了数据的物理独立性。问题2选项:A.模式到内模式:模式(表名)存储在内存中,内模式是对应表中存储数据的部分,通过建立映像,实现了数据的逻辑独立性。B.外模式到内模式:外模式(视图名)存储在内存中,内模式是对应表中存储数据的部分,通过建立映像,实现了数据的物理独立性。C.外模式到模式:模式(表名)存储在磁盘中,模式是对应表中存储数据的部分,通过建立映像,实现了数据的逻辑独立性。D.外模式到外模式:外模式(视图名)存储在磁盘中,视图是对应表中存储数据的部分,通过建立映像,实现了数据的物理独立性。4、文心一言的回答:
选择答案为B. 外模式到内模式。数据库的视图是一个虚拟表,它由一个或多个基本表组成,并且只包含基本表中的数据,不包含基本表中的索引或外键。视图通过建立外模式到内模式之间的映像,保证了数据的逻辑独立性。基本表与存储文件之间通过建立外模式到外模式之间的映像,保证了数据的物理独立性。试题二结果,正确答案为
:
问题1选项中,正确答案是:C.外模式到模式。问题2选项中,正确答案是:A.模式到内模式。大家可以看出,试题二的难度要大于试题一,因为试题二中涉及了2个问题,这里就考验ai助手对文字的逻辑分析能力了。
从结果看,ChatGPT回答正确且给出了过程分析,claude回答正确一半(问题1正确,问题2错误)。
而,通义千问和文心一言全部回答错误,其实,通义千问就没有给出明确的答案;文心一言只给出一个答案,也没有明确说出答案是针对问题1还是问题2。
结束语:以上只是一个小小的测试,为大家提供一个小小的参考,目前ai助手的能力不代表未来的能力。
在知识问答领域,各个AI助手各具特色,表现各有优劣。虽然无法轻易判断哪个AI助手绝对优于其他,但从当前的数据表现来看,ChatGPT在知识问答方面确实展现出了一定的优势。
人工智能的发展为知识问答与学习提供了更加智能的解决方案,人们可以选择最为适用的AI助手来解决自己遇到的知识盲点与困惑。但是AI助手的知识与能力仍然有限,在复杂的知识问答与推理上仍无法完全取代人的判断。所以,在重要的考试或决策中,人们依然需要发挥自己的主观判断,AI助手更适合作为一种实现辅助或者初步解答的工具。
AI时代,拥有个人微信机器人AI助手!AI时代不落人后!
免费ChatGPT问答,办公、写作、生活好得力助手!
搜索微信号aigc666aigc999或上边扫码,即可拥有个人AI助手!